Dave Airlie ecd7963f7c Merge tag 'drm-amdkfd-next-2018-07-28' of git://people.freedesktop.org/~gabbayo/linux into drm-next
This is amdkfd pull for 4.19. The major changes are:

- Add Raven support. Raven refers to Ryzen APUs with integrated GFXv9 GPU.
- Integrate GPU reset support

In addition, there are a couple of small fixes and improvements, such as:

- Better handling and reporting to user of VM faults
- Fix race upon context restore
- Allow the user to use specific Compute Units
- Basic power management

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.
See Documentation/00-INDEX for a list of what is contained in each file.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
